SUMMARY:IRS Correspondence Challenges: Navigating Resolution Amid Delays and Workforce Reductions
DESCRIPTION:Description\n\n\n\nRecent reductions in the IRS workforce along with a government shut down have introduced new challenges for tax professionals managing correspondence and case resolutions. While enforcement actions have slowed temporarily\, limited staffing has resulted in processing delays\, misrouted responses\, and increased frustration for both practitioners and clients.This course provides tax professionals with practical strategies to communicate effectively with the IRS and manage cases efficiently despite extended response times. Participants will learn how to use available IRS tools\, implement proven communication tactics\, and maintain productivity in the face of systemic slowdowns. The course also covers proactive methods to anticipate and adapt to ongoing IRS operational changes\, helping practitioners guide clients confidently through an evolving enforcement landscape. \n\n\n\nUpon completion of this course\, participants will be able to:1. SUMMARY:Monitoring & Remediation: Building a Practical\, Risk-focused Plan for Your Firm
DESCRIPTION:As firms continue to refine their risk assessment\, monitoring\, and remediation processes\, expectations around how monitoring is designed and executed are evolving. This intermediate-level session provides a practical look at what firms should be watching for\, how anticipated changes may affect monitoring activities\, and how to translate those insights into a workable monitoring and remediation plan.  \n\n\n\nParticipants will hear perspectives from local and regional-focused firms on actions already undertaken\, lessons learned\, and how monitoring plans are being structured across timing\, people\, and methodology. The session will also explore internal inspection approaches and the role of technology in supporting monitoring and remediation efforts.
